Output 240c415029c6b57821fc17f8103b20f38038610e8c72b758f85534a539fc47c2:1

value
130693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2db5b557f2430438e7cfed5f34abd36c5402877 OP_EQUALVERIFY OP_CHECKSIG
address
1LDugTh6UVy1X3CUua492GscnELqJj3wLA
transaction
240c415029c6b57821fc17f8103b20f38038610e8c72b758f85534a539fc47c2
confirmations
588703
spent
true